What does it take to convert a 250 engine to a 350....I have a really cool opportunity to get a running driving 77 van but the engine is pretty small for what I want to do (pull a BBQ smoker). I imagine that engine mounts are not the same....is there other things I should be aware of.
Posted By: Wedgy Re: 250 to 350 engine - August 08th 2020 1:11 pm
Done this once or twice. Yes on the v8 motor mounts. Chevy V8 will bolt up to chevy auto trans, OD units as well. Hell, even bell housings for manual trans. Lol. You will need exhaust manifolds, exhaust. I am unsure what headers will fit a van, but I've seen them installed. More radiator, aux trans coolers for towing.
